
Security – Voluntary adoption of the NIS 2 Directive
Security update
We are pleased to inform you that Comestero Sistemi S.r.l., although not currently subject to the obligations of the NIS 2 Directive, has voluntarily chosen to embark on a structured path to align with the main European and international cybersecurity standards.
In particular, we are implementing:
• the requirements of Directive (EU) 2022/2555 – NIS 2;
• the CIS Controls versione 8.1 framework for IT infrastructure protection.

What we are implementing
| Area | Status |
| Mapping of critical assets and risk | Started |
| Adoption of CIS Controls IG1 (essential safeguards) | In progress |
| Definition of IT security policies and governance | In implementation |
| Incident response and business continuity planning | In drafting phase |
| Staff training on NIS 2 principles and cyber hygiene | Scheduled |
| Continuous monitoring and security audits | Scheduled |
